In the Monroe area, a complete walk-in tub installation typically ranges from $8,000 to $15,000+, depending on the tub model, features, and the complexity of the plumbing and electrical work required. Local factors that can influence cost include the need for potential upgrades to Monroe's older home plumbing systems, the accessibility of your bathroom for installers, and the cost of disposing of your old tub, which may involve fees at local transfer stations like the Monroe Solid Waste Facility.
Monroe's harsh winters can significantly impact installation schedules. Snow and ice can delay deliveries of the tub unit to your home and hinder installer access. It's highly advisable to schedule your installation for late spring, summer, or early fall to avoid these delays. Furthermore, ensuring a clear, plowed path to your entry door on installation day is your responsibility and is crucial for a smooth process during the colder months.
Yes, most walk-in tub installations in Monroe will require a plumbing permit from the town's Code Enforcement Officer, and if electrical work for new jets or heaters is involved, an electrical permit may also be necessary. Reputable local installers will typically handle this permitting process for you. It's important to verify that any contractor you hire is licensed and insured in the State of Maine to perform this specialized work.
Prioritize providers with extensive local experience in Maine's older housing stock, as they will be familiar with common challenges like limited bathroom space, slate foundations, or outdated plumbing. Seek out companies with verifiable local references in Waldo County and confirm they carry full liability insurance and worker's compensation. A trustworthy provider will offer an in-home consultation in Monroe to assess your specific bathroom and needs before providing a detailed quote.
This is a very valid and common concern given Monroe's climate. High-quality walk-in tubs designed for colder regions feature superior insulation in the tub walls and door to retain heat. During your selection process, specifically ask about the tub's insulation rating (R-value) and consider models with a heated backrest and a rapid-fill system to minimize wait time in the tub before bathing, ensuring a comfortable and warm experience even in an unheated bathroom.
